**TICKET QV-armoury locked out**

Vault holding the Pixelgrid snapshot-testing baselines is sealed after three bad unlock attempts. New folks: snapshot diffs for UI components won't run until the vault opens, so CI is red. Don't regenerate baselines manually. Ping the Foxhollow rotation if unsure. To unseal, enter the recovery passphrase shown below.

unlock words, kagef-taduf: fenir-quenix-norwyn-sorvan-gormir-gorir-fraok

Hey — handover notes on the Pindlecast fan-out service before I'm out next week.

Short version: backpressure kicks in when the delivery queue passes its high-water mark, and we shed low-priority notifications first. Don't raise the worker count without also bumping the drain interval, or you'll just thrash. Mira can walk you through the dashboards. Current production settings that govern all of this are listed below.

settings of yaguf-bahip:
druwyn:
  log_level: debug
  metrics_host: metrics.druwyn.qorvelsys.internal
  pool_size: 32

Hey Priya — handover for the week. If anyone needs the server room at Dunmore Court after hours, they have to sign the blue log first (it lives on my desk, top drawer). Security does a walk-by around 23:00, so warn them not to prop the door. Escort contractors the whole time, no exceptions. The badge reader's been flaky, so there's a backup keypad. The after-hours keypad code is below.

door code, yagap-bahof: bdg-O-05